Types of Laundry Appliances

1. Washing Machines

Washing machines are crucial for cleaning up clothes and be available in numerous types, each with special performances.

  • Front-Loading Washers: Known for their efficiency and mild washing, front loaders consume less water and energy. They typically include advanced functions but can be pricier.

  • Top-Loading Washers: Generally more affordable and easier to load, these washers are quicker however tend to utilize more water and energy.

  • Washer-Dryer Combos: Ideal for little spaces, these all-in-one appliances wash and dry clothing in a single unit, though they may do not have the effectiveness of separate machines.

2. Dryers

Dryers enhance washing machines and can be found in a number of types as well.

  • Vented Dryers: These dryers expel hot air outside and are usually more affordable. However, they require correct venting.

  • Condenser Dryers: Without requiring ductwork, they make use of a tank to gather water from the drying procedure. They are more flexible but may take longer to dry clothes.

  • Heat Pump Dryers: Extremely energy-efficient, these clothes dryers utilize heat exchange innovation to recycle hot air. They are more pricey upfront but minimize energy costs gradually.

Secret Features to Consider

When shopping for laundry appliances, consider the following features:

Capacity

  • Choose based upon your household size.
  • Bigger capabilities are ideal for families, while compact models suit apartments or single residents.

Efficiency Ratings

  • Search For Energy Star-rated models to minimize electricity and water costs.

Wash/Dry Cycles

  • Examine for multiple cycles such as delicate, sturdy, or quick wash choices.

Smart Features

  • Numerous modern-day washers and clothes dryers offer Wi-Fi connection, enabling you to monitor cycles from your mobile phone.

Sound Level

  • If you live in a small space, think about a model known for its peaceful operation.

Warranty and Service

  • A lot of leading brands offer service warranties; decide for a design with excellent after-sales service and assistance.

Setup and Maintenance

Proper setup and continuous maintenance are crucial for optimizing the life-span and performance of laundry appliances.

Installation Tips

  • Expert Installation: Consider employing experts, specifically for gas connections or venting setups.
  • Leveling: Ensure appliances are leveled to decrease sound and vibrations.

Upkeep Tips

  • Routine Cleaning: Clean the lint filter in clothes dryers and run cleansing cycles for washers.
  • Check Hoses: Periodically examine hose pipes for wear and replace them as required.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ION

1. How typically should I clean my washing machine?

It is advisable to run a cleaning cycle when a month, specifically if you notice any smells or residue.

2. What is the best way to load a washing machine?

Do not overload the machine; it's best to leave some space for clothes to move easily, which aids with cleaning.

3. Are energy-efficient models worth the financial investment?

Yes, while they might have a higher upfront cost, energy-efficient models conserve cash in the long run on energy expenses.

4. Can I stack washing machines and clothes dryers?

Yes, but ensure you have the suitable stacking package and that the models are designed for stacking.

5. Do I require a vent for a dryer?

Vented clothes dryers need a vent to expel air; condenser and heatpump dryers do not require external venting.
